Summary
A vulnerability, which was classified as critical, has been found in libxml2 up to 2.10.2. This issue affects some unknown processing of the component XML Document Handler. The manipulation leads to memory corruption. This vulnerability is traded as CVE-2022-40303. It is possible to initiate the attack remotely. There is no exploit available. It is advisable to upgrade the affected component.
Details
A vulnerability, which was classified as critical, has been found in libxml2 up to 2.10.2 (Document Processing Software). This issue affects an unknown functionality of the component XML Document Handler. The manipulation with an unknown input leads to a memory corruption vulnerability. Using CWE to declare the problem leads to CWE-119. The product performs operations on a memory buffer, but it can read from or write to a memory location that is outside of the intended boundary of the buffer. Impacted is confidentiality, integrity, and availability. The summary by CVE is:
An issue was discovered in libxml2 before 2.10.3. When parsing a multi-gigabyte XML document with the XML_PARSE_HUGE parser option enabled, several integer counters can overflow. This results in an attempt to access an array at a negative 2GB offset, typically leading to a segmentation fault.
The weakness was shared 11/23/2022 as c846986356fc149915a74972bf198abc266bc2c0. The advisory is shared at gitlab.gnome.org. The identification of this vulnerability is CVE-2022-40303 since 09/09/2022. It demands that the victim is doing some kind of user interaction. Neither technical details nor an exploit are publicly available.
The vulnerability scanner Nessus provides a plugin with the ID 211168 (Fedora 37 : libxml2 / xmlsec1 (2022-a6812b0224)), which helps to determine the existence of the flaw in a target environment.
Upgrading to version 2.10.3 eliminates this vulnerability. The upgrade is hosted for download at gitlab.gnome.org. Applying the patch c846986356fc149915a74972bf198abc266bc2c0 is able to eliminate this problem. The bugfix is ready for download at gitlab.gnome.org. The best possible mitigation is suggested to be upgrading to the latest version.
